A new software application is now available to generate realistic compartment fire scenarios quickly and accurately. The app uses a simplified heat release rate (HRR)–time model derived from large-scale fire data and automates the creation of both HRR curves and temperature–time histories.
Key properties of the app:
-
Generates HRR and temperature–time curves based on fuel load, ventilation, and compartment geometry.
-
Compatible with deterministic and probabilistic analysis, allowing thousands of fire scenarios to be simulated efficiently.
-
Produces results validated against large-scale fire tests, with reliable predictions of peak compartment temperatures.
-
Provides distributions of critical parameters such as flashover time, maximum HRR, and duration above key temperature thresholds.
-
Designed for easy use in performance-based and risk-informed fire safety engineering.
